Well we are back after a total round trip of 3200 door to door,we used £440 in fuel which I was very happy about.
Had to have the balancing done while we were in Marbella but at 10 Euros that was ok.
The car performed like a dream, averaged around 80mph on the motorways. temp gauge never moved,didn't use any water and the roof box stayed where it was supposed to !
Two problems occured whilst we were away which I am very unhappy about. A Spaniard drove into the front wing and drove off before I could react and get his number plate and I parked in the wrong place in a town called Mijas and the police towed the car away. Took me 4 hours and 210 Euros to get it back.. Oh well. Now have to take the car to a garage in Enfield that the AA has told me to and see if they are going to write it off or repair it (te damage that was done the day before the holiday).

Welcome back and delighted to hear that the motoring went so well. It is always a particular joy to have your own car with you as anything you might rent locally is never quite the same.

Sadly, it seems you have picked up quite a bit of battle damage, before the trip and during it. It would be sensible to have a plan ready in the event of "write off" - buy it back and repair it? If it is excellent mechanically, it is worth a thought. I generally find that repairs can be done for well less than the insurance estimate, so the nett cost may not be that bad. Worth getting a quote from someone locally to give you a benchmark in preparation for your chat with the insurers.

My car has now been written off by the insurance company. I have had to send them the history,mot and log book and now have to wait for an offer. They did say if I wanted to keep the car it would be sold back to me very very cheaply so after doing over 3000 miles to Marbella and back and then up to Manchester and back with no problems at all and minimal fuel used I think I would like to keep it.Does seem to be more oil dripping now though and the exhaust is blowing again.I don't think any of it is major stuff. Unless they offer me lots (I don't think so) I will keep it and pocket some cash as well to start doing her up.

Well I had a settlement from the insurance today.
I paid £1272 off Ebay for the car.
Insurance gave me £1850
I bought the car back for £420 and after paying the excess I am left with £1180...Nearly as much as I paid for the car !

Not too bad I think.
